Predicts which lapsed donors are most likely to give again — so win-back budget goes where it can actually recover income. What it predicts — For lapsed supporters, the probability they give again in the next window. Who it scores — Genuinely lapsed donors: people who gave at some point in the longer history (e.g. within five years) but not in the recent period (e.g. the last year). Currently-active donors are excluded. The decision it drives — Prioritise win-back appeals: spend reactivation budget on the lapsed supporters most likely to respond, and leave the truly gone alone. Worked example — A reactivation mailing to the whole lapsed file is expensive. Scoring it first, the team mails the top-ranked half and recovers most of the win-backs at far lower cost. What good looks like — More reactivations per euro of win-back spend.
